Janitor

Essential Job Functions:  (May not include all tasks as each contract site is specific to customer requests.)

  • Removes trash and recycling, disposes in designed areas. Clean trash containers inside and out and replenishes liner. Vacuums all carpeted areas and rugs. Sweeps/dust mops and wet mops all ceramic and hard floors. Wet dusts/vacuums base boards.
  • Cleans, sanitizes and disinfects urinals, toilets, stall partitions, sinks, vanities, fixtures, showers, walls, in restrooms. Replenishes all soap, paper and plastic products. Sweep and mop floors.
  • Washes windows, window sills, blinds/window coverings. Vacuum and clean furniture. Spot clean stains.
  • Wet/dry dust most horizontal surfaces, not touching work related or personal items on desks. Dust ceiling fixtures, air conditioning and return vents.
  • Removes and disposes of litter in entrance ways, hallways, lobby/waiting rooms, outdoor sitting and recreational areas.
  • Maintains awareness of proper safety procedures and guidelines, applies cleaning procedures to meet standards.
  • Performs other work as assigned by supervision.
